Abstract
The effect of Jahn-Teller phonons on the magnetic and orbital structure of is investigated using a combination of relaxation and Monte Carlo techniques on three-dimensional clusters of octahedra. In the physically relevant region of parameter space for and after including small corrections due to tilting effects, the A-type antiferromagnetic and C-type orbital structures were stabilized, in agreement with experiments.
